The Data-Driven Product: Research Techniques for Informed Decisions
In today's rapidly evolving market landscape, companies are increasingly recognizing the significance of data-driven decision making. To achieve this, development teams must leverage a range of research techniques to gather meaningful insights about their target audience, competitors, and market trends.
Measurable research methods, such as surveys and A/B testing, provide concrete data that can be used to measure hypotheses and track the success of product features. Exploratory research techniques, like user interviews and focus groups, offer compelling understanding into user needs, motivations, and pain points.
By integrating both quantitative and qualitative approaches, development teams can gain a holistic view of the market and make informed decisions that lead to market success.
